CBI DSP moves HC against Alok Verma's decision to reverse transfer orders of officers

Press Trust of India  |  New Delhi 

CBI Deputy SP Devender Kumar Thursday moved the against Verma's decision to reverse transfer orders of various officers.

The plea is likely to be listed for hearing on Friday before Justice Najmi Waziri, who has already reserved verdict on various petitions of Special Rakesh Asthana, Kumar and middleman seeking to quash the bribery against them.

Kumar, in his application filed in the pending petition, has sought direction to the CBI to not allow Verma and other retransferred officers to deal with against him and others in any manner.

Verma joined the office on Wednesday, 77 days after he was sent on forced leave by the central through a late-night order on October 23, 2018, which was set aside by the on Tuesday.
